[bugfix] fix possible mutex lockup during streaming code (#2633)

* rewrite Stream{} to use much less mutex locking, update related code

* use new context for the stream context

* ensure stream gets closed on return of writeTo / readFrom WSConn()

* ensure stream write timeout gets cancelled

* remove embedded context type from Stream{}, reformat log messages for consistency

* use c.Request.Context() for context passed into Stream().Open()

* only return 1 boolean, fix tests to expect multiple stream types in messages

* changes to ping logic

* further improved ping logic

* don't export unused function types, update message sending to only include relevant stream type

* ensure stream gets closed 🤦

* update to error log on failed json marshal (instead of panic)

* inverse websocket read error checking to _ignore_ expected close errors
